Сценарий Python генерирует ошибку сегментации. Я не могу найти источник проблемы.Как это отладить segfault просто в Python?Существуют ли рекомендуемые методы кодирования, чтобы избежать ошибок сегментации?
Я написал скрипт (1600 строк) для систематической загрузки файлов CSV из источника и форматирования собранных данных.Сценарий работает очень хорошо для 100-200 файлов, но через некоторое время он систематически завершает работу с сообщением об ошибке сегментации.
-Сбой всегда происходит в одной и той же точке сценария, без понятной причины - я запускаю его на Mac OSXно сбой также происходит в Ubuntu Linux и Debian 9 - Если я запускаю процедуры Pandas, которые вылетают во время моего сценария на отдельных файлах, они работают правильно.Сбой происходит только тогда, когда я повторяю скрипт 100-200 раз.-Я проверил содержимое каждой переменной, конструкторы ( init ), и они, кажется, в порядке
Код слишком длинный для вставки, но доступен по требованию
Ожидаемый результат - выполнение до конца.Вместо этого он падает после 100-200 итераций